Transaction 77dcc42fc38c78fd99630830307552d247f6be463c9e26a6461628ee62926ef1
1 Input
1 Output
-
77dcc42fc38c78fd99630830307552d247f6be463c9e26a6461628ee62926ef1:0
- value
- 61593392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12c9e1fc093212efac7ab2fcd2e04daf26ceb21d OP_EQUAL
- address
- 33QMw4DPGCZFPRfc1ANqZhdyFz79gSwHSb